Gari Michael Keeney, 30, of West Springfield, passed away unexpectedly on April 5, 2020. He was a lifelong resident of West Springfield and worked for many years at Hastie Fence in Agawam. Gari was the beloved son of Kathleen Bourassa and David Keeney; the proud father of Kiera Keeney; the loving...
